CALDWELL, N.J. -- Caldwell University's
women's and
men's cross country squads face a six-meet Fall 2025 regular season, including the Cougar Chase Invite at Garret Mountain in Woodland Park, N.J., in preparation for the CACC Championships on Oct. 26 at Belmont Plateau in Philadelphia, as announced by seventh-year Head Coach
Kyle Price.
Caldwell opens the slate on Saturday, September 6, at the "Back to the Bowl" event in Holmdel, N.J., hosted by Stevens Tech. After the Golden Eagle Invite on Long Island on Sept. 13 and Stockton's Osprey Open on Sept. 20, Caldwell will host the Cougar Chase before closing out the regular season with the Highlander Invite in Pennsylvania on Oct. 4 and St. Joseph's Invite on Long Island on Oct. 18 before the league championship event, hosted by Thomas Jefferson University.
The Caldwell men's team placed second at the CACC Championships last year, by far its best finish ever.
Top returners for the women include seniors
Chennaya Tschopp (Belleville, N.J.) and
Isabella Pollock (Fair Lawn, N.J) and junior
Dayanara Grau (Union City, N.J.).
The men's roster features leading holdovers, junior
Logan Kudla (Bloomfield, N.J.) and soph
Luke Molyneux (Ocean Township, N.J.)
